FIFO INTERRUPT MODE OPERATION  
B. Character times are calculated by using the  
RCLK input for a clock signal (this makes  
the delay proportional to the baudrate).  
When the RCVR FIFO and receiver interrupts  
are enabled (FCR bit 0 = "1", IER bit 0 = "1"),  
RCVR interrupts occur as follows:  
C. When a timeout interrupt has occurred it is  
cleared and the timer reset when the CPU  
reads one character from the RCVR FIFO.  
A. The receive data available interrupt will be  
issued when the FIFO has reached its  
programmed trigger level; it is cleared as  
soon as the FIFO drops below its  
programmed trigger level.  
D. When a timeout interrupt has not occurred  
the timeout timer is reset after a new  
character is received or after the CPU reads  
the RCVR FIFO.  
B. The IIR receive data available indication also  
occurs when the FIFO trigger level is  
reached. It is cleared when the FIFO drops  
below the trigger level.  
When the XMIT FIFO and transmitter interrupts  
are enabled (FCR bit 0 = "1", IER bit 1 = "1"),  
XMIT interrupts occur as follows:  
C. The receiver line status interrupt (IIR=06H),  
has higher priority than the received data  
available (IIR=04H) interrupt.  
A. The transmitter holding register interrupt  
(02H) occurs when the XMIT FIFO is empty;  
it is cleared as soon as the transmitter  
holding register is written to (1 of 16  
characters may be written to the XMIT FIFO  
while servicing this interrupt) or the IIR is  
read.  
D. The data ready bit (LSR bit 0)is set as soon  
as a character is transferred from the shift  
register to the RCVR FIFO. It is reset when  
the FIFO is empty.  
B. The transmitter FIFO empty indications will  
be delayed 1 character time minus the last  
stop bit time whenever the following occurs:  
THRE=1 and there have not been at least  
two bytes at the same time in the transmitter  
FIFO since the last THRE=1. The transmitter  
interrupt after changing FCR0 will be  
immediate, if it is enabled.
